The Double Hustle: Juggling Two Remote Jobs Simultaneously

In today’s fast-paced world, the idea of working multiple jobs has gained immense popularity, especially with the rise of remote work. Many individuals are exploring the option of taking on multiple jobs to enhance their income, develop new skills, or simply pursue their passions. However, managing two remote jobs can be challenging and requires strategic planning and organization. This article will guide you through the essential steps to successfully juggle two remote jobs while maintaining your work-life balance.

Understanding the Benefits of Working Multiple Jobs

Before diving into the how-tos of managing multiple jobs, it’s crucial to understand the potential benefits:

  • Increased Income: The most obvious benefit is the potential to significantly boost your earnings.
  • Diverse Skill Set: Working in different roles can help you acquire a variety of skills that can enhance your career prospects.
  • Networking Opportunities: Each job brings new connections, which can be beneficial for future opportunities.
  • Job Security: Having multiple sources of income can provide a safety net in uncertain economic times.

Step-by-Step Guide to Juggling Two Remote Jobs

1. Assess Your Capacity

Before taking on multiple jobs, evaluate your current workload and personal commitments. Consider the following:

  • How many hours can you realistically dedicate to each job?
  • Do you have any other commitments that might interfere with your work?
  • Are you mentally prepared for the added responsibility?

2. Choose the Right Jobs

Selecting jobs that complement each other can make your juggling act easier. Here are some tips:

  • Find Flexible Roles: Look for jobs with flexible hours that allow you to adjust your schedule as needed.
  • Avoid Conflicting Responsibilities: Ensure the roles do not overlap in terms of skills or client base.
  • Consider Remote Jobs in Different Fields: This can prevent burnout and keep your work interesting.

3. Create a Detailed Schedule

Having a clear schedule is crucial when managing multiple jobs. Use digital calendars or planning tools to map out your days. Here’s how:

  • Block out specific times for each job.
  • Include breaks to avoid burnout.
  • Be realistic about how much time each task will take.

4. Communicate Clearly with Employers

Transparency is key. Inform your employers about your situation if required. This can help manage expectations and build trust. Here are some points to consider:

  • Clarify your availability for each job.
  • Set boundaries to ensure you meet deadlines without overcommitting.

5. Stay Organized

Maintaining organization is vital when handling multiple jobs. Consider the following tips:

  • Use Project Management Tools: Tools like Trello or Asana can help you keep track of tasks.
  • Maintain Separate Workspaces: Having distinct areas for each job can enhance focus and productivity.

Troubleshooting Common Challenges

Even with careful planning, challenges may arise. Here’s how to handle them:

1. Time Management Issues

If you find yourself struggling to manage your time effectively, consider:

  • Reassessing your schedule to identify areas for improvement.
  • Implementing time management techniques like the Pomodoro Technique.

2. Burnout

Working two jobs can lead to burnout. To combat this:

  • Schedule regular breaks and leisure activities.
  • Practice self-care and prioritize mental health.

3. Overlapping Responsibilities

If tasks from both jobs start to overlap, consider the following:

  • Re-evaluate your workload and possibly delegate tasks.
  • Set clear priorities for what needs to be accomplished first.
